How Much Does Hedge Maintenance Stafford Cost?
Costs for hedge maintenance in Stafford vary depending on the size of the hedge, the species, its condition, and the frequency of visits. Here is a general guide to help you budget:
- Small garden hedge trim (up to 1m height): Typically £50–£100 for a straightforward single-sided trim.
- Medium hedge trimming (1–2m height): Usually £100–£200 depending on length and access.
- Large or tall hedge maintenance (2m+): Can range from £200–£500+ for substantial boundary hedges requiring specialist equipment.
- Hedge reduction: Generally £150–£400 depending on the scale and difficulty of the work involved.
- Waste removal and disposal: Often included but can attract an additional fee of £50–£150 for large volumes of material.

Frequently Asked Questions — Hedge Maintenance Stafford
How often should I have my hedge trimmed in Stafford?
Most hedges benefit from trimming two to three times per year. Fast-growing species such as Leylandii may need more frequent attention, while slower-growing varieties like beech or yew typically require one to two cuts annually. Regular maintenance keeps hedges healthy, tidy, and easier to manage long-term.
What is the best time of year for hedge maintenance?
The best times to trim most hedges are late spring (May–June) and late summer (August–September). Avoid cutting during nesting season (March–August) where possible, as disturbing nesting birds is illegal under the Wildlife and Countryside Act 1981. Is hedge maintenance in Stafford something I can do myself?
Smaller, low-level hedges can be maintained by a competent homeowner with the right tools. However, tall or large hedges involving ladders, specialist equipment, or significant waste disposal are best left to professionals for safety reasons.
